Fantastic Four Box Office Collection Day 1: Film Nabs HUGE Opening

Marvel’s First Family Makes a Strong Debut. The Highly Anticipated Film Rakes in Millions on Opening Day

July 26, 2025: The US box office opened with a bang for Marvel Studios’ highly anticipated movie, The Fantastic Four: First Steps. It made $56 million on its first day. This is a great start for the renowned superhero team to join the Marvel Cinematic Universe (MCU) on July 25.

“Fantastic Four: First Steps” Nabs Strong $56 million on opening day, neck and neck with “Superman”. The movie’s opening day box office puts it in a tough race with James Gunn’s “Superman,” which made $56.5 million. “The Fantastic Four: First Steps” had the third-best opening day in the US this year. It made $57.11 million, which is a little less than “A Minecraft Movie” but more than “Lilo & Stitch” ($55.94 million). The $56 million includes $24.4 million made from previews on Thursday night.

Comscore/Screen Engine’s PostTrak reports that the film’s audience demographics reflect a solid general audience turnout (93%), with 7% being kids under 12. In comparison, “Superman” had 31% of its audience made up of parents and kids (9% under 12).

“The Fantastic Four: First Steps” is a big deal since it formally brings Marvel’s First Family into the MCU now that Disney owns 20th Century Fox. Matt Shakman directed the movie, while Kevin Feige produced it. The cast includes Pedro Pascal as Reed Richards (Mister Fantastic), Vanessa Kirby as Sue Storm (Invisible Woman), Joseph Quinn as Johnny Storm (Human Torch), and Ebon Moss-Bachrach as Ben Grimm (The Thing). Julia Garner also plays the mysterious Silver Surfer, who was a big part of the trailer that came out in April.

The official summary says the movie takes place in “the vibrant backdrop of a 1960s-inspired, retro-futuristic world,” where the crew meets their “most daunting challenge yet.” The goal of this reboot is to be different from earlier versions. The Tim Story-directed “Fantastic Four” (2005) opened to $56 million, while its 2007 sequel, “Fantastic Four: Silver Surfer,” opened to $58 million. Josh Trank’s “Fantastic Four” (2015), a Fox-Marvel movie that came out more recently, made $25.6 million on its first day.

The figures in the US are strong, but sources from India say that “The Fantastic Four: First Steps” had a slower start, making about ₹5.10 crore (about $610,000 USD) on its first day. It faced tough competition from Bollywood movies that were released around the same time. But it is expected that the film’s opening weekend will do well around the world.
